Get started19 The Daglands is a semi-detached house in Camerton, Bath, Bath (BA2 0PR). It has a recorded floor area of 85 m² (around 915 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(September 2025)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. Earlier certificates rated it B (September 2014); the latest reading is 2 bands l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average and hot-water ef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.
19 The Daglands's carbon output is low for the local stock.
19 The Daglands has no Land Registry sales on file,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ands since registration began.
